Thanks, JP. This allowed me to narrow down the problem. We currently do not have logic to support PIL Tiff objects, so they end up embedded in an object array. In the meantime, the matplotlib plugin does work for me: import skimage.io as sio sio.use_plugin('matplotlib') img = sio.imread('1.tiff') Cheers Stéfan
